Welcome to on-call for the Glimmerpane design system! Our snapshot tests live in the `snapcheck` suite and run on every merge to main. If a UI component changes visually, the diff bot flags it — usually it's an intentional tweak, so just approve the new baseline. If it's 2am and snapshots are failing across the board, it's almost always a font-loading race, not your problem. To unlock the baseline store and re-approve snapshots in bulk, use the recovery passphrase below.

recovery phrase for tahag-taguf: wenix-caswyn

Ticket: Nightfill plugins failing to connect during the 2am window. Hey plugin folks — we've had a handful of reports that third-party backfill plugins are timing out when the Nightfill scheduler hands them a job. Looks like the pooler is capping connections lower than documented, so late-starting plugins get refused. Workaround for now: retry with jittered backoff and keep your plugin's pool size at two or less. To reproduce locally, point your plugin at the staging coordination database via the connection string below.

replica DSN, yahaf-yagaf: mongodb://tamath_svc:a2netSk3RZMuTj@db-d084.novacsoft.internal:5432/ralmir

**Q: Why do stale prices keep showing up in the Brimble catalog?**

Short version: our invalidation fan-out in Shelfwork only fires on SKU updates, not on category merges, so cached listings linger up to an hour. Quick fix for the sync: run the purge job manually after any merge. Dara is patching this next sprint. If you need to unlock the purge console, use the recovery passphrase below.

unlock words, hahip-baduf: holwyn-istath-julvan

Quick note on sorting in the Quillbench report builder: sorts are stable, so rows that tie on the chosen column keep their original ingest order. That means you can chain sorts by applying them in reverse priority — handy for multi-level reports. To try this against the sandbox API, send your requests with the bearer token below.

session JWT of yawep-yawep = eyJhbGciOiJIUzI1NiIsInR5cCI6IkpXVCJ9.eyJzdWIiOiI3pWF3_In0.aXYsHiog